From Kuala Lumpur to Ipoh you can travel by bus, train or private taxi.
Travel from Kuala Lumpur to Ipoh by tourist bus, KTM train, or private taxi. The bus is the cheapest option, taking 3–5.5 hours with tickets from $4–11. Most buses depart from TBS Kuala Lumpur.
The KTM ETS train is the fastest public transport, taking 2.5–3 hours and costing $7–11 per person. Private taxis take about 2–3 hours. From Ipoh you can continue to Penang or to Alor Setar.
There are no direct flights on this route. Ipoh is famous for its colonial architecture, limestone caves, and excellent local food, making it a popular stop between Kuala Lumpur and Penang.

The cheapest and most popular way to travel from Kuala Lumpur to Ipoh is by tourist bus. Companies such as Mara Liner, KPB Express, Billion Stars Express, Sri Maju Group, Starmart, Plusliner and others operate frequent daily services.
Most buses depart from TBS Kuala Lumpur and arrive at AmanJaya Bus Terminal in Ipoh. Departure and arrival information is displayed when booking tickets online.
The bus journey takes about 3–5.5 hours, depending on traffic. Modern buses offer air-conditioned cabins and comfortable reclining seats.
Bus tickets cost about $4–11 per person. Book online in advance, especially on weekends and holidays.
Arrive at TBS Kuala Lumpur at least 30 minutes before departure. Bus travel is the best choice for budget travelers visiting Ipoh.

The KTM ETS train is one of the best ways to travel from Kuala Lumpur to Ipoh. Trains depart from KL Sentral Railway Station and arrive at Ipoh Railway Station. You can also check the Malaysia railway map before your trip.
The journey takes about 2–3 hours, with several departures every day. Train tickets cost about $7–11 per person, making the train a fast, comfortable, and affordable option.
You can book train tickets online in advance without printing them—simply show the QR code on your phone before boarding. It is recommended to arrive at KL Sentral about 30 minutes before departure.

A private car with a driver is the fastest and most comfortable way to travel from Kuala Lumpur to Ipoh. It offers hotel pickup in Kuala Lumpur and direct transfer to your destination in Ipoh.
The journey takes about 2–3 hours. Companies such as Daytrip, FQD Travel, ZMT Enterprise, Dusky Leaf Adventure, Columbia Leisure, Khaimal Travel and Tours, THS Transportation, and Asian Overland Services operate on this route.
Private cars and minivans cost about $120–300 per vehicle, depending on the vehicle type. Minivans are a good choice for families and small groups.
